Transaction 59ec63a594871333e0e1cbc07f4cdfc0e19ba292a018ab25f2307de64e24496f
1 Input
1 Output
-
59ec63a594871333e0e1cbc07f4cdfc0e19ba292a018ab25f2307de64e24496f:0
- value
- 70655023
- script pubkey
- OP_0 OP_PUSHBYTES_20 a55bb939676c178fe0311c219c324aa48f4e103c
- address
- bc1q54dmjwt8dstclcp3rssecvj25j85uypusw2z58